C++ programlama eğitimi, katılımcılara C++ diliyle uygulama geliştirme becerisi kazandırır. Veri yapıları, etkili veri yönetimini öğretir ve anlamak için kritiktir. Nesne yönelimli programlama, karmaşık yapıları yönetmeyi kolaylaştırır. Eğitim, ayrıca sistem programlama konularını da ele alır. Yüksek performanslı grafikler, görsel uygulamalar için önemlidir. Oyun geliştirme, eğlence endüstrisinde önemli bir rol oynar. C++ eğitimi, katılımcılara bu alanlarda uygulamalar geliştirmek için gereken bilgiyi verir.
Standart kütüphaneler, kod yazma sürecini hızlandırır ve kolaylaştırır. Fonksiyonlar, kodun yeniden kullanılabilir ve yönetilebilir olmasını sağlar. Diziler, birden çok veri öğesini düzenli bir şekilde saklar. Pointçiler, veriye doğrudan erişim sağlar ve performansı artırır. Sınıflar, nesne yönelimli programlamada temel yapı taşlarıdır. Nesneler, gerçek dünya varlıklarının temsilleridir. Dosya işlemleri, veriyi kalıcı olarak saklama yeteneğini öğretir. Ayrıca hata yönetimi, programların güvenilir ve stabil çalışmasını sağlar.
Sınıf ve nesne kalıtımı, kodun yeniden kullanımını artırır. Polymorphism, nesnelerin farklı tiplerde olmasına olanak tanır. Eğitim, C++’ın avantajlarını ve gücünü gösterir. C++’ın geniş kullanım alanları, eğitimi alacakları çeşitli kariyer yollarına yönlendirir. Sistem programlama, işletim sistemleri ve düşük seviyeli uygulamalar için temeldir. Grafik ve multimedya, görsel içerik üretiminde kullanılır. Ayrıca veri madenciliği, büyük veri setlerinden bilgi çıkarmak için kullanılır.
Katılımcılar, bu eğitimle karmaşık uygulamalar geliştirir. Modern C++ tekniklerini öğrenmek, kod kalitesini artırır. Performans iyileştirmeleri, uygulamaların daha hızlı çalışmasını sağlar. Ayrıca Eğitim, katılımcıları mevcut uygulamaları C++ ile geliştirmeye teşvik eder. Derinlemesine C++ bilgisi, katılımcılara güçlü bir temel sağlar. Eğitim, ayrıca problem çözme ve algoritma becerilerini geliştirir.
Kısacası, C++ programlama eğitimi, katılımcılara kapsamlı bir C++ bilgisi sağlar. Bu bilgi katılımcılara nasıl modern uygulama geliştireceklerini ve mevcutları uygulamaları nasıl iyileştireceklerini öğretir. Bu bağlamda eğitim, programlama dünyasında başarılı bir kariyer için gereken becerileri kazandırır.